Transaction 3696df5c2eda3b9107330f17f5157790cb30a31ddb15fb10ab160fc472e48258
1 Input
1 Outputs
- 3696df5c2eda3b9107330f17f5157790cb30a31ddb15fb10ab160fc472e48258:0
value 335520
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c